วันจันทร์ที่ 8 สิงหาคม พ.ศ. 2565

Error OLE Error Code 0X80040154 record number 92

 เมื่อเปิดโปรแกรม แล้วมี error ขึ้นว่า 

Error: "OLE Error Code 0X80040154 - Class not registered" record number 92

สาเหตุเกิดจาก ไม่มีตัว active x (.ocx) ที่ชื่อ mswinsck.ocx ในครื่อง หรือมีแต่อาจจะยังไม่ได้ register โปรแกรมจึงถามหาตัวควบคุมดังกล่าว




วิธีแก้ไข

1.copy ไฟล์ comctl32.ocx ใส่ไว้ใน system32 (C:\windows\system32)

2.click ที่ start พิมพ์ cmd ในช่องค้นหา

3.Click ขวาที่ ไฟล์ cmd เลือก เลือก run as Administrator

4.พิมพ์ regsvr32 mswinsck.ocx แล้ว enter

กรณีที่ command prompt ไม่ได้อยู่ในตำแหน่ง C:\windows\system32

ให้พิมพ์ cd C:\windows\system32 แล้ว enter

แล้วค่อยพิมพ์ regsvr32 comctl32.ocx




กรณี windows 64 bit

1.copy ไฟล์ comctl32.ocx ใส่ไว้ใน SysWOW64 (C:\windows\SysWOW64)

2.click ที่ start พิมพ์ cmd ในช่องค้นหา

3.Click ขวาที่ ไฟล์ cmd เลือก เลือก run as Administrator

4.พิมพ์ regsvr32 C:\windows\SysWOW64\comctl32.ocx แล้ว enter



หลังจาก Register ตัว mswinsck.ocx หน้าต่างรับส่งธุรกรรม เปิดใช้งานได้ปกติ



Download comctl32.ocx (my google drive)

The resourse file is not valid. Overwrite it with a new empty one?

เมื่อเปิดโปรแกรม แล้วขึ้น Error

The resourse file is not valid. Overwrite it with a new empty one?




อาจเกิดจากปัญหาเกี่ยวกับ FOXUSER.FTP และ FOXUSER.FPT



วิธีแก้ไข

ให้ลอง ลบ ไฟล์ทั้ง 2 ตัวนี้ทิ้งไป แล้ว ลองเปิดโปรแกรมใหม่อีกครั้ง


หรืออาจเกิดจาก ค่า Config ในตัว config.fpw


ซึ่ง ถ้าเป็นโปรแกรม SIP09 ค่า config ของ resourse = off ครับ ตามภาพด้านล่างครับ

ถ้าตรวจสอบดูแล้วเป็นอย่างอื่นให้เปลี่ยนเป็น off



วันอังคารที่ 2 สิงหาคม พ.ศ. 2565

ไม่ได้รับ SMS หรือ รหัส OTP

ไม่ได้รับ  SMS หรือ รหัส OTP  ตัวอย่างเช่น

การลงทะเบียน ขอรับวัคซีนป้องกัน COVID-19 เข็มกระตุ้น ผ่านระบบมือถือ โดย AIS โดยเมื่อกรอกเบอร์โทรศัพท์ และกดขอรหัส OTP ไม่ปรากฏ รหัส OTP ส่งเข้าเบอร์มือถือเป็นต้น

โดยอาจจะเกิดจาก SMS ในเครื่องเรามีจำนวนมากเกินไป หรือเต็ม ให้ลองลบข้อความเก่าทิ้งดู แล้วลองทดสอบส่งข้อความหรือทำการขอรหัส OTP ใหม่อีกครั้ง

หรืออาจจะเกิดจากปัญหาเครือข่ายของผู้ให้บริการเอง หรืออาจเกิดจาก ตัว Application บางตัว มีการ block sms หรือ รหัส OTP 

หรือาจเกิดจาก App ประเภท Call blocker ต่างๆที่ติดตั้งไว้ในเครื่องเรา

ถ้าเป็นกรณีฝั่งผู้ให้บริการเครือข่ายสัญญาณโทรศัพท์ ก็อาจต้องติดทาง call center โดยที่ทาง call center ตรวจสอบให้แล้วและแจ้งว่าสามารถส่ง ข้อความเข้ามือถือเราได้ตามปกติ แต่เรากลับไม่เห็นข้อความ 

เราอาจต้องมาตรวจสอบ Application ในเครื่องของเราเองครับว่า ได้ download app ที่เกี่ยวกับเรื่อง Security หรือ App ที่ใช้สำหรับ Block เบอร์ไว้บ้างหรือไม่ 

ถ้ามี ลองไปตรวจสอบการตั้งค่าการ block ดูว่าได้ตั้งค่าการ block เกี่ยวกับ SMS ไว้บ้างหรือไม่ หรืออาจจะลองถอนกอนติดตั้งไปเลย แล้วลองส่ง sms อีกครั้ง

ในตัวอย่างนี้ ขอยกตัวอย่าง App ที่ชื่อว่า ตัวเพิ่มประสิทธิภาพ ซึ่งเป็น app ที่ติดมากับ โทรศัพท์ HUAWEI 


ซึ่งจะมีฟังชั่นการทำงานส่วนของปิดกันการโทร และข้อความ SMS รวมอยู่ด้วย



เมื่อเปิดเข้าไป และ เลือกที่กฏการปิดกั้น จะมีส่วนต่างๆดังภาพ

โดยจะเห็นว่ามีส่วนของปิดกั้นการโทร และ การปิดกั้นข้อความ



ให้ลองเข้าไปตรวจสอบ ในส่วนของ กฏการปิดกั้นข้อความ

โดยถ้ามีการเปิดฟังชั่นการปิดกั้น SMS ไว้ ก็จะมีรายการ SMS/OTP ที่ถูก block แสดงอยู่ในรายการ block list ดังภาพ



ฟังชั่นการปิดกั้นข้อความถูกเปิดใช้งานอยู่ ทำให้ SMS ต่างๆ รวมถึงรหัส OTP จะถูก block โดย App นี้ทั่้งหมด ยกเว้น ข้อความจากเบอร์ที่อยู่ใน Contact list เท่านั้นจะสามารถส่ง SMS หาเราได้



เมื่อเราปิดฟังชั่นการปิดกั้นข้อความ




SMS หรือ รหัส OTP เราจะเห็น ระบบ SMS / รหัส OTP ได้เหมือนเดิม


ตัวอย่าง App ที่มีความสามารถด้านการ block

เช่น App กันกวน App เกี่ยวกับ Antivirus หรือพวก app cal blocker ต่างๆ

ตัวอย่าง app